Cascade Township Michigan Real Estate Market Report ~ Cascade Woods -August 2009

Cascade Woods is an established neighborhood of large, executive

style homes in Cascade Township, MI. Most of these homes were

built in the 1960's and 1970's, although there are a few newer

homes that were built recently in the area. Close to the village of

Cascade and the Thornapple  River, this heavily wooded area has

 been a Grand Rapids desired suburban place to live for  decades. 

 Part of the Forest Hills School District, which draws many families,

there is also the river and it's picturesque appeal.  The drive down

Thornapple River Drive between Ada and Cascade in the fall is one

of the prettiest drives in the greater Grand Rapids area.

   Cascade Woods Market Report    August 2009

 

    12 Homes For Sale,  1 Pending,  3 SOLD, 6 Expired

Cascade Woods Active Listings: 12

Cascade Woods Average price - $294,108

Cascade Woods Average $/SqFt - $124.41

Cascade Woods Average days on market - 85

Cascade Woods Sold Listings: 3

Cascade Woods average price - $239,333

Cascade Woods average $/SqFt - $ 77.54

Cascade Woods average days on market - 148 days

Cascade Woods Expired Listings: 6

 

The Absorption Rate for Cascade Woods Homes is 24 months,

Which means if no new listings come on the market, it will take

24 months to sell the existing inventory.  The average sold price

per SqFt is still 40% of the Active listings Price /SqFt.  This

 could reflect foreclosures, short sales, and homes in poor condition

 that have sold over the last 4 months.

 Or it could be home condition which is slowing the sales of

older homes in this area.   

 While the spring market has seen a slight uptick in prices paid

for Cascade Woods homes, the absorption rate is sobering at

24 months, while newer homes are selling briskly.

Today's buyers do not want to do ANY updates, which includes

painting, new kitchens & baths, and new flooring. If your Cascade

Woods home hasn't sold, it is probably condition,  which gets

us back to price.  If you don't want to improve your home, you

 won't get the same price as people who have updated and kept

their home current according to recent trends.
